A few personal policies: - Meet and greets *required* for all dog bookings and are ideal for cat bookings as well, but go on a case-by-case basis. - Currently unable to walk multiple large dogs at the same time (unless they are truly the easiest walkers in existence 🥲) due to a recovering injury. - Key pickup/drop off: For our first booking, I’m happy to grab the key from you during our meet and greet and we can arrange a way to leave keys behind at the end of the booking. I highly suggest getting a lockbox for your keys if you don’t have keyless entry. Any coordination for additional visits to exchange keys, have me pick them up, or drop them off at any location will be $10-15 (depending on distance/if I need to pay to park) each to cover my time/travel expenses. - All pets need to be up to date on vaccines

Pet care experience
I worked in various positions at an animal shelter for 4 years, even taking animals to school for educational presentations as well as to news stations for promotional segments. Lifelong large dog, cat, and critter caretaker. I lost my everything—my 14yo big headed, chocolate, tripod angel girl, Hazel—in January 2026, so any extra time with all of my regulars and new pet friends is appreciated. I also have a perfect, grumpy-faced cat, CC ❤️ Experience with various behavioral and medical needs (love a naughty pet), bathing and grooming, special needs and feeding, and enrichment activities. I will probably assign some sort of personalized voice and personality to your pet if I’m not already aware of them. Happy to be active with the active ones and lazy with the lazy ones.
